Using Lights to Maximize Duck Egg Production - Part Two

In last week's blog, we talked about how long the day length should be to maximize duck egg production. Now I want to go over the types of lights to use, the use of time clocks and how geese are completely different than other poultry in terms of light stimulation.
The choice of bulb depends on how many birds you have to light. If you have a small flock, a single 100 watt incandescent bulb is sufficient. Fluorescent bulbs are more efficient than incandescent. The most efficient, which most commercial poultry operations use, are high pressure sodium lights. This is what we use. They are often used as street lights and give off an orange colored light.




A high pressure sodium light in our duck breeder building.

Birds are stimulated reproductively by the orange/red spectrum in light. Incandescent and sodium lights have plenty of these colors. If you have a choice with your fluorescent bulbs, try to get the more natural colored tubes and not the cool white tubes which have more of the blues and greens in them.
There are two basic time clocks. Industrial time clocks are wired into your electrical system and can control a complete circuit containing many lights. The home type of time clock is one that plugs into an outlet and is normally used in a home to turn a light on and off. One of the advantages of the industrial type is you can make as small an adjustment as you want when you want to change on and off times. You just loosen the screw, move it slightly and re-tighten it. They are also heavy duty for a long life and can handle quite a few lights.

The main advantage of the home type is they are easy to find and use. A disadvantage of the home type is that it has plug-in on/off switches with a minimum adjustment of 15 minutes. Another disadvantage of the home type time clock is that they normally do not have a grounding plug or slot.

Most people cannot see their birds' lights in the evening and morning. So how do you know the time clock is really working? We plug a home style time clock into the circuit of lights that are coming on and off each night. Nothing is plugged into this time clock – we just use it as a monitoring device. The dial on this time clock is set at 12:00. Every morning we check to see how long the time clock has run the previous night and then turn it back to 12:00. If your lights are supposed to be on for two hours in the evening and two hours in the morning, then the time clock should read 4:00 in the morning when you pick up eggs. If it doesn't, then something is not working correctly. Of course this will not tell you if a bulb has burned out - but only if your time clock is working correctly.




Monitoring time clock to  make sure the controlling time clock is working properly - must be reset to 12:00 each morning.


It is probably better to have two smaller lights instead of just one big light in case one bulb burns out. The birds will not be as adversely affected with some light versus no light.
If your birds have access to an outside pen during the night, you should light that pen, too. You want them exposed to the light, no matter where they bed down at night. By the way, the light enters the brain directly, it does not go through their eyes – so the light stimulates them whether they are awake or asleep.
Geese are unique in how light stimulates them reproductively. No one photo-stimulates geese in North America to maximize egg production - as is typically done with other poultry. The reason is that excessive light (meaning 13+ hour lighted day lengths) depresses egg production in geese. For other poultry you maximize egg production with 16-17 hour days. You can only achieve maximum egg production in geese by providing a maximum of 10-11 hour days! Looking at the light charts from last week's blog, you can see that most of the time our days are longer than 11 hours – and this is too long for maximum egg production for geese. So to maintain egg production as long as possible in geese, you need light tight houses – which means no natural light enters the building. The only light is provided by lights so you can provide them only 10 or 11 hours of light a day - no matter the time of year. More on this later.

How to Use Lights to Increase Duck Egg Production

Originally posted by John Metzer on Thu, Nov 11, 2010 @ 01:11 PM 

The use of artificial lights is very important in extending the egg production of ducks.  An increasing day length (December 21 to June 21) stimulates birds to lay more eggs and shorter days (June 21 to December 21) stimulate them to lay fewer eggs and eventually stop egg production.  Therefore, the control of day length is very important in starting, maintaining and stopping egg production in ducks.






To start egg production
When we stimulate our duck breeders to start egg production in December, we add ¾ of an hour in the morning and ¾ hour in the evening to the natural day length.  Then every 3-4 days we add another half hour alternating between the morning and evening until we get to a total of 17 hours of light and 7 hours of dark.

To maintain egg production
It is important that you increase your day length to equal the longest day of the year in your latitude.  Why?  So that your ducks never notice the days getting shorter starting June 21.  Let us assume your longest natural day length is 17 hours but you only added enough artificial light in the spring to go up to 16 hours.  Well, your birds will be subjected to increasingly shorter days from June 21 until some time in July or August when the natural day length is down to 16 hours.  And they will lay fewer eggs because of this shortening of their day.  From that point on they will have 16 hours of light, but some of the damage will have already occurred.




To stop egg production
If you want your birds to go into a molt, turn off the artificial lights.  This will help shock their system into a molt and rest period.

Intensity of Light
Birds do not need an intense light to stimulate them.  It can be as little as .5 footcandle but it is probably better to get a level of 3-5 footcandles.  In general this means sufficient light to read a newspaper.  Oftentimes this light level is met about a half hour prior to sunrise and stops a half hour after sunset.

The following charts show the natural day length of three latitudes in the US.  You can set your day length according to these charts.  If you prefer, you can go the Gaisma website for a chart like this for your city.    For exact sunrise and sunset times for every day of the year in your town, you can go to the US Navy Oceanography website.  You want to use the civil sunrise and sunset times (the sun is 6 degrees below the horizon) as this is about the point the light is at about 3-5 footcandles.

These charts are marked in military time – 6 is 6am, 12 is noon, 18 is 6pm.  Sample cities for each sample latitude are shown below each chart.
